Besides the cluster that is the need for an additional Baton Rouge bridge. Everyone benefits from a new bridge.

It can be a new hwy exit, tunnel, bridge, border wall, levee, locks, resurfacing...whatever.

I live in Youngsville and drive Hwy 90 daily b/w Opelousas and New Iberia with occasional trips to NOLA. It beats the hell out of my truck.

Life would be better for me if they ever connect I-49 from Lafayette to NOLA. New surface. No red-lights or congestion in Lafayette would be nice. Interstate grade would be much safer of a drive, too.

What say you?

quote:

I49 does not run west/east. It runs North South. I10 is west/east.


WTF. 49 was supposed to connect Lafayette to Nola in a kinda curved diagonal NW to SE path. Lack of Funding and powerful Nimby's nipped it over 25 yrs ago and continue to nip it, with the greatest adverse impact being on truckers going between Houston & Nola and residents of Baton Rouge.
